Information on Core 2 Duo U7700 and Core i7-660UE compatibility with other computer components: motherboard (look for socket type), power supply unit (look for power consumption) etc. Useful when planning a future computer configuration or upgrading an existing one. Note that power consumption of some processors can well exceed their nominal TDP, even without overclocking. Some can even double their declared thermals given that the motherboard allows to tune the CPU power parameters.

Pros & cons summary


Recency 27 July 2006 2 August 2010
Threads 2 4
Chip lithography 65 nm 32 nm
Power consumption (TDP) 10 Watt 18 Watt

Core 2 Duo U7700 has 80% lower power consumption.

i7-660UE, on the other hand, has an age advantage of 4 years, 100% more threads, and a 103% more advanced lithography process.
